Watermelon salad is a refreshing dish that combines the sweetness of ripe watermelon with savory and tangy ingredients, often inspired by Mediterranean or Middle Eastern cuisines. Commonly featured components include diced watermelon, creamy feta cheese, fresh mint, red onion, and a light dressing made from olive oil and lime juice. Variations might include cucumber, arugula, or balsamic glaze for added depth. This salad is packed with hydration and nutrients, thanks to watermelon’s high water content and vitamins such as A and C. The inclusion of mint and lime juice adds antioxidants, while olive oil provides heart-healthy fats. However, the feta cheese adds sodium, so it’s best enjoyed in moderation, especially for those watching salt intake. Watermelon salad is a perfect choice for a light and nutritious summer dish or snack.
